1. China

Many new online sellers opt to source products from China due to their low prices and quick production capabilities, which allows them to keep up with trends. It's generally understood that the quality often aligns with the price, meaning products might not be highly durable. Historically, a downside was the need to travel there for sourcing.

However, the landscape for online sellers has evolved. You can now source products by ordering directly from Chinese websites and negotiating with suppliers online. Several popular Chinese websites offer a vast selection of products at competitive prices with straightforward shipping, including:

  • Taobao - A major Chinese online marketplace known even before e-commerce became widespread. It offers a diverse range of products across all categories, including clothing, tableware, electronics, and much more.
  • AliExpress - Available as both a website and an app, AliExpress features products from Chinese and Hong Kong sellers. It spans numerous categories like fashion, watches, children's toys, bags, shoes, and more. A key advantage is the ability to purchase directly from factories and manufacturers, cutting out middlemen.
  • Alibaba - A colossal e-commerce platform, Alibaba is a hub for all kinds of goods, from clothing and sports equipment to home decor and cosmetics.
  • 1688 - Similar to Taobao, Alibaba, and AliExpress, 1688 offers a good balance of price and quality. Crucially, it covers every product category, including adult and children's clothing, food, and accessories.
  • Tmall - Comparable to platforms like Lazmall and Shopeemall, Tmall hosts highly reputable stores. Prices tend to be higher than general marketplaces, as it focuses on selling high-quality products with certified production standards.

2. Sampeng Market

Did you know that Sampeng is a popular wholesale market where online sellers frequently source their products? It's the largest wholesale hub in Thailand, primarily featuring goods imported from China by Thai merchants who then sell them at wholesale prices. This makes it one of the first places people consider for sourcing products, both for online and physical stores. Crucially, it offers products in almost every category, including:

  • Fashion apparel
  • Cosmetics
  • Household items
  • Toys
  • Stationery

Additionally, you can find raw fabrics, bulk textiles, dried foods, and much more. If you know what you want to sell but are unsure where to source it, Sampeng is the first wholesale market you should explore. If you plan to visit, be sure to check Sampeng's opening hours, as it operates in two shifts: daytime from 7:00 AM to 6:00 PM, and a morning market (night shift) from 4:00 AM to 6:00 AM.

3. Rong Kluea Market

Many might assume Rong Kluea Market is solely for second-hand goods, but in reality, it also sells new products. After a period of closure during the COVID-19 pandemic, Rong Kluea Market has reopened, presenting a great opportunity for new online sellers to find products to sell. The market offers a wide and comprehensive range of products, including items from neighboring countries, such as:

  • Clothing
  • Bags
  • Shoes
  • Jewelry
  • Silverware
  • Tableware
  • Electrical appliances
  • And more

Beyond these, you can find fruits from China, goods from Vietnam, and both new and second-hand items from Korea, Japan, America, and various other countries. However, if you plan to visit Rong Kluea Market to source products, you'll need to plan carefully as the market is vast, divided into five zones:

  • Golden Gate Market - Sells both new and second-hand goods.
  • New Rong Kluea Market - Specializes in bags.
  • Old Rong Kluea Market - Known for good condition second-hand goods.
  • Det Thai Market - Offers both new and used shoes.
  • Benjawan Market - Sells new products directly from factories.

4. Handmade Products

Handmade or D.I.Y. products require minimal investment and equipment, making them an excellent alternative for sellers who prefer not to source from general markets where products might be similar to other stores. Instead, by purchasing raw materials for handmade items, you can create and sell unique products online with just a bit of creativity. You can find wholesale suppliers for D.I.Y. materials at the aforementioned online sources like Chinese websites, Sampeng, and Rong Kluea Market.

Once you have your products, start promoting them on Facebook and Instagram. If you see potential, then create dedicated store pages and accounts to begin selling seriously. If you hit the right product niche, success is almost guaranteed, as handmade items are unique and one-of-a-kind. Essentially, crafting and selling your own products can be a lucrative online venture.

5. Custom Manufacturing

Many who aspire to sell online and build their own brand often choose not to source products from others but instead opt for custom manufacturing with their unique designs and branding. This method is ideal for online sellers with substantial capital, as custom production typically involves specific designs and special orders.

For instance, if you're custom manufacturing your own clothing line, cosmetics, soaps, shoes, skincare, or other products, you'll need reserve capital for additional expenses such as:

  • Packaging costs
  • FDA/regulatory approvals
  • Certification fees
  • Shipping costs
  • Design fees
  • And more

Therefore, if you prefer to custom manufacture rather than source pre-made products, you'll need a significant investment.

7. Pre-order Products

Pre-order products are another popular choice among online sellers. This method involves taking orders without needing to stock inventory, making sales straightforward. Simply select products that resonate with your target audience, then photograph and post them for sale. Once a customer places an order, you purchase and ship the item. Naturally, you'll add a service fee for handling the pre-order. This approach is highly favored by customers who lack time or cannot travel to purchase items themselves.

An example of a store that successfully sells pre-order products with massive online sales is the Products from Japan page. If you observe closely, you'll notice that this page selects only high-quality products that meet customer needs. They also feature highly engaging content and product captions. If you plan to sell products via pre-order, you don't need to source large quantities at once. Just identify your store's unique selling proposition, and customers will easily become loyal.
